  • When a magnet is dipped in iron filings, we can observe that the iron filings cling to the end of the magnet as the attraction is maximum at the ends of the magnet. These ends are known as poles of the magnets.
  • Magnetic poles always exist in pairs.
  • Like poles repel while unlike poles attract.

Fishes, shrimps, sharks, sea horse, jellyfish, and lobsters are having the ability to breathe underwater on their own. Fishes having gills which are filled with blood vessels intakes oxygen by taking water through its mouth and the blood vessels present in it absorbs oxygen and pass it to the fish cells while disposing of the water absorbed through the gill passages.

A landform is a feature on the Earth's surface that is part of the terrain. Mountains, hills, plateaus, and plains are the four major types of landforms. Minor landforms include buttes, canyons, valleys, and basins. Tectonic plate movement under the Earth can create landforms by pushing up mountains and hills.

Tears prevent dryness by coating the surface of the eye, as well as protecting it from external irritants. There are no blood vessels on the surface of the eye, so oxygen and nutrients are transported to the surface cells by tears. Foreign bodies that enter the eye are washed out by tears.

Soils are complex mixtures of minerals, water, air, organic matter, and countless organisms that are the decaying remains of once-living things. It forms at the surface of land – it is the “skin of the earth.” Soil is capable of supporting plant life and is vital to life on earth.
